Key changes to system services / configs

> NetworkManager-wait-online is taking very long as suggested by systemd-analyze blame. This service is now disabled:

    sudo systemctl disable NetworkManager-wait-online.service

Bluetooth keyboard:

/etc/bluetooth/main.conf
FastConnectable = true


/etc/tlp.conf
USB_AUTOSUSPEND=0

/etc/default/grub
# append

G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="usbcore.autosuspend=-1 btusb.enable_autosuspend=0"
# then grub-mkconfig .... and reboot

Audit:  [NO ACTION TAKEN] In a recent fiasco, it was pointed out that
        vultr (as cloud service provider) altered their ToS to grant
        vultr "non-exclusive, perpetual, irrevocable, royalty-free,
        fully paid-up wordwide license" to use user content. Vultr
        responsed that the ToS was interpreted out of context, and
        modified their ToS for clarification [1]. Therefore no action
        will be taken against vultr, but it's worth the record here.
